Apprentice Plant Operator
Plant Operatives check, prepare, maintain & operate several machines that are used on construction sites, such as:
360 excavators to dig or shape the ground to form embankments or trenches for underground pipes Dumper to transport earth across a site and tip it where required Ride-on-Roller to compact materials such as earth and tarmac for roads, paths etc. Forklift to lift and transport construction materialsThey provide signals to other operators & marshal vehicles on site and assist with any labouring required on site.
Training:
You will achieve the Level 2 Construction Plant Operative Apprenticeship Standard by attending CP Assessments Training Centre’s in Doncaster to undertake 7 block-release training sessions (5 days), every 8-12 weeks.
The successful candidate will work towards their Functional Skills in both Maths and English if they have not achieved this prior or have an equivalent.
Apprentices will also get an Apprentice CSCS card which can be upgraded on completion of the apprenticeship.
